Output 5514ff0100598533814c3cfbd50c3623f0c011736d4945e89257ac4d7cb591ec:1

value
688649658
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46dbe5904e7ef118b33143512707e5292921f1c3 OP_EQUALVERIFY OP_CHECKSIG
address
17Tfj824ZpaHqLn8GJphnCgzkmR2LNWPu7
transaction
5514ff0100598533814c3cfbd50c3623f0c011736d4945e89257ac4d7cb591ec
spent
true